如何使用 grep 检查大于特定持续时间的日志?

如何使用 grep 检查大于特定持续时间的日志?
grep -lw  -e '0123456789' application.log_2023-07-*

我想要大于 2023-07-* 的日志,如何实现?

类似问题:

grep 特定日志条目大于特定时间

答案1

您需要至少使用两种模式(在同一行中),一种用于 7-9,另一种用于 10-22。

application.log_2023-0[7-9]-* application.log_2023-1[0-2]-* 

如果您还希望在下一年使用相同的命令,还可以为该年份添加通配符。

application.log_202[4-9]-*-*

相关内容